Good, but not Great

Let me just start off by saying this is my first Pokemon game since D/P/P. I have read up on the games since then though.

Pros:

- Best graphics of the series. Isn't really saying much, but it's there.

- Fairy types. About time dragon got a nerf. Steel and poison buffs are okay, though whether they'll actually increase usage is debatable.

- Super Training. The end of grinding IV training. Now if only they'd make the EV guy easier to use.

- Mega-Evolution. It's just really cool. Incredulously unbalanced, but really cool.

- Only 75ish new Pokemon. Most people say this is a bad thing for some reason. But I've never been a fan of the hundred or more new Pokemon introduced in most generations. First of all, there are too many Pokemon already. Secondly, I think the quality of Gen 6's mons are a lot better, with a few notable exceptions.

- Friends. Your in-game friends were less two dimensional. And they actually spent time with you.

- Online play. Online play in this game is great. Wondertrade, O-powers, all of it.

- Looker missions. Really nice change of pace actually. And it had an actual plot.

- Lumoise City. It's so big and actually city-like.

- Anti-Frustration Features. They should've had these a long time ago.

- Plot length. Somehow, even with all the time saving, the main plot took me over 40 hours. That's probably because I tend to dawdle, but still.

Cons:

- Fairy types. Bug got a very unnecessary nerf.

- Pokemon Ami. This is really a personal preference. But I wasn't a fan. Maybe it's just because I'm heartless.

- Plot. Never Pokemon's strong suit, so this is just a general complaint about the series.

- Difficulty. I like this version of the EXP share, but could they not at least had the elite 4 go up in levels when you faced them again?

- Team Flare. I hope they were supposed to be as silly as they are.

- Post game. Besides the looker missions, there was really no post game. Not compared to D/P/P, anyways. This is my biggest complaint. I want some sort of replay value.

- 3D. Would've been nice to have a fully 3D Pokemon game, even if I rarely use 3D.

- Friends. In my opinion, Trevor and... that dancing kid were both incredibly annoying. Your rival's kind of annoying too, but at least they help out. Shauna's probably the most tolerable, but even then.

Overall: 8/10
